Delta Air Lines is set to expand its operations at Austin-Bergstrom International Airport (AUS) with the launch of five new nonstop routes starting in Spring 2025. This expansion will position Delta as having the second-largest market share at AUS based on daily departing flights.

The airline will resume nonstop service to Memphis, Tennessee, and introduce four new nonstop destinations: Panama City, Florida; Tampa, Florida; San Francisco, California; and Indianapolis, Indiana. These flights will operate once daily throughout the week.

The Panama City, Indianapolis, and Memphis routes will be served by SkyWest’s fleet of Embraer 175s under the Delta Connection carrier. The San Francisco and Tampa routes will be served by the Airbus 220-300 aircraft. Passengers traveling on these latter routes can enjoy Delta’s fast free wifi onboard along with over 1,000 hours of inflight entertainment options. Eligible customers can also access the Delta Sky Club at AUS.
